Canelo vs. Kirkland Delivers Top Performing Fight on HBO Since 2006

More than 31,000 fans gathered at Minute Maid Park to watch Canelo vs. Kirkland live on May 9th. Fight fans also tuned in droves to watch the fight on HBO as they averaged an average viewership of 2,146,000 for the live fight and peaked at 2,296,000 vieweres. This is the top-performing bout on HBO since Tarver vs. Hopkins delivered 2,460,000 viewers in 2006.

“With more than 31,000 people coming to Minute Maid Park and more than 2.1 million tuning in to watch on HBO, Canelo Alvarez is quickly making the leap from the biggest boxing star of the future to the biggest star of the present,” said Oscar De La Hoya, founder and president of Golden Boy Promotions. “Given his sizzling, fan-friendly performance in knocking out James Kirkland, attendance will only continue to soar. Boxing’s future is now.”

Boyd Melson and Rafael Vazquez Win in Return to Broadway Boxing

On Friday night DiBella Entertainment staged it’s Broadway Boxing Series for the second time this year in front of a sold-out crowd at the Hilton Westchester in Rye Brook, NY.

Boyd “Rainmaker” Melson made his ring return against Mike Ruiz in the welterweight division. Melson outboxed Ruiz and won a unanimous decision with scores of 100-89, 99-90, and 98-91 and improved to 14-1-1.

Junior featherweight Rafael Vazquez earned his seventh victory in a row by outboxing Pedro Melo over eight rounds. He won on all three scorecards with scores of 80-70 and improved to 14-1.

International Women’s Boxing Hall of Fame Ceremony Scheduled for July 11, 2015

On July 11, 2015 the sport of Women’s boxing will return to Ft. Lauderdale for the induction ceremony of the second class of the Women’s Boxing Hall of Fame. All inductees will be in attendance at the Hyatt Regency Pier Sixty-Six to receive their plaudits.

The inductees will include Laila Ali, Laura Serrano, Ann Wolfe, Jeannine Garside, Diedre Gogarty, Terri Moss, Sparkle Lee, and Phyllis Kugler.
